While Silverdale Train Station may not boast a wide array of facilities, it covers the essentials to ensure a comfortable journey for all. The station is equipped with ticket machines from which you can collect pre-purchased tickets. Additionally, an induction loop system is in place for those who may benefit from hearing assistance. For those in need of purchasing or validating smartcards, Silverdale is ready to assist, although it lacks validators for smartcards.
Accessibility at the station is quite comprehensive, with step-free options available, although travelers should be aware that assistance from staff is not offered. Helpful ramps are available to improve access on and off platforms, and there's a seating area for those waiting for their train. While there are no waiting rooms or accessible toilets available, the station provides bicycle storage with eight dedicated spaces on Platform 1.
Connectivity from Silverdale is enhanced with a range of travel options. For those needing alternatives due to train disruptions, a rail replacement service operates from bus stops on Red Bridge Lane. Although taxis aren't readily available on-site, they can be booked online for hassle-free travel, and Northern Railway offers a handy taxi service found at northernrailway.co.uk/tickets/cab4you. Local buses also connect Silverdale to nearby towns and attractions, promising easy transitions between different modes of transportation.

For those looking to purchase or collect tickets, the ticket office is open from 6:00 AM to 11:00 PM every day, including weekends, and there are accessible ticket machines for your convenience. The station also offers step-free access throughout the premises, ensuring that passengers with limited mobility can travel with ease. Additionally, CCTV cameras are in operation to ensure your safety and security.
While you wait for your train, you’re welcome to use the public toilets, which are available from 4:00 AM to 11:00 PM daily, and the accessible bathrooms feature baby changing facilities. Although there are no designated waiting rooms or seating areas, the station is equipped with a help point and staff assistance is available at any time should you need it.
When it comes to onward travel, Southend Airport train station does not disappoint. If you're planning to explore London, you can catch a train to London Liverpool Street or Stratford (London). Prefer to stay local? Head to Southend Victoria, a central location perfect for exploring the seaside town. For those venturing further afield, there are trains to Chelmsford and Colchester, offering a pleasant blend of urban and rural experiences.
If you're in need of a cab, the information for taxis can be found through Northern Railway's Cab4You service. Bus services are also readily accessible, providing ample options to connect with local areas.
